Opihi Picker Pulled From Ocean by Bystanders

An opihi picker was transported to Hilo Medical Center this morning after being pulled from the ocean by bystanders off the King’s Landing area of Hilo.
Fire department paramedics arriving at the Pumaile area at the end of Kalanianaole Avenue administered cardio-pulmonary resuscitation to the unidentified man.
An ambulance, the fire department’s Chopper 1 and a rescue boat from the Waiakea Fire Station responded to the incident.
The man’s condition was not immediately available.
